EL PASO, Texas - Feb. 2, 2015 - PRLog -- The undisputed number one bull rider in the world, 20 year old CBR and PRCA World Champion Sage Steele Kimzey, is set to ride next week in the annual Casa Ford Tuff Hedeman Championship Bull Riding presented by the Casino at Sunland Park Racetrack.  On February 7th in the El Paso County Coliseum, bull riding fans will have the rare opportunity to see Kimzey, who won the El Paso event here last year which launched his quest for the CBR World Championship he won in July in Cheyenne.  He then would go on to rewrite the rodeo record books last December at the National Finals Rodeo.

With 30 years of bull riding history on his resume, Tuff Hedeman is one of the most recognizable cowboys in the history of rodeo, but he defers to the young super star that is currently the CBR and PRCA World Champion, as the best bull riding talent he has seen in over 15 years.

“Kimzey is a rare talent who rides fundamentally flawless,” said Tuff Hedeman, the 4 time world Champion who now produces the nationally televised Mahindra Road to Cheyenne Tour events. “He puts forth incredible effort each time he pulls his rope,” continued Hedeman.

This year’s event in El Paso has not only attracted Kimzey, but the roster features Mexico native Juan Alonzo who has ridden three out of three bulls this year to jump start his professional career.  Also returning to El Paso are three former World champions and several of the most talented bull riders on the professional tours today including 2012 World Champion Josh Barentine, Johnson’s Bayou, LA., CBR World Champ Cole Echols, Frierson, La., 2012 PRCA Word Champion Cody Teel from Kounzte, Tex., 2-time 2014 NFR round winner from Dallas, Aaron Pass, and Mexico native Juan Alonzo, Westlaco, Texas.

This year’s event is the seventh stop on the Mahindra Championship Bull Riding’s (CBR) Road to Cheyenne Tour which pits the industry’s elite riders against the best bulls in a three round tournament style action with this year’s intermission entertainment featuring the Escaramuza Charra Villa Dorada, a ladies horseback team.

There are no guarantees in bull riding; the only way for cowboys to earn a paycheck is to ride better than the rest of the 24-man field.  The field of competition which starts with 24 riders, then 12 and finally 4 in the Shoot Out where they will battle for the lion’s share of $30,000 in prize money. The night’s excitement will culminate as the final four bull riders will get a third opportunity to ride in a winner take all ending. The format appeals to new spectators and established fans alike because riders can challenge as many as three bulls in one performance.

 In addition to lucrative prize money, bull riders accumulate points which qualify them for the World Finals, part of the legendary Cheyenne Frontier Days celebration held Wyoming next July. At the end of the World Finals, the contestant who has the most points will be crowned the world champion and receive a $100,000 bonus.
